WebWe can compute the range of any sign-and-magnitude representation. First, let us compute the range for 1 sign bit and 7 magnitude bit. So, the range of is from (-127) 10 to (+127) 10 which contains 255 numbers. WebMar 20, 2024 · Both gravitational and electric forces decrease with the square of the distance between the objects, and both forces act along a line between them. In Coulomb’s law, however, the magnitude and sign of the electric force are determined by the electric charge, rather than the mass, of an object.
